An urgent question asking why her department decided to cancel this year's Food and Drink Festival was put to a minister in today's House of Keys sitting.
Arbory, Castletown and Malew MHK Jason Moorhouse asked the Minister for the Department of Environment, Food and Agriculture Clare Barber how the decision was reached.
Mrs Barber responded saying that change was needed, with a focus on a series of smaller events.
